Prof. Dr. Zhiyuan Liu is one of the major contributors in the research field in transmission voltage level vacuum circuit breaker in China. His team developed the first 126kV/2500A/40kA single-break vacuum circuit breaker in China, which passed type test in 2013. The contribution is toward to reduce SF6 gas usage in high voltage switchgear. SF6 gas is a strong global warming effect gas pointed by Kyoto protocol. In the field of transmission voltage level vacuum circuit breaker, he held 128 Chinese patents and 2 US patents. He published 520 technical papers, mainly in the field of vacuum circuit breaker, including vacuum arc, vacuum insulation, operating mechanism ect.
